I'm coming late to this one, but I reckon this from agent sparrow sums up my thoughts on it quite well

So basically I think you can be pro-cannabis/legalisation, and still see it as a substance to be treated with care and as one that can act as a trigger of psychotic breakdown in a minority of people. In fact I think its a much better way of approaching the subject than the "it can't cause any harm at all" approach.

while it may well be true that canabis hasn't actually killed anyone, the concept that it is an entirely benign substance is bollocks, and potentially harmful bollocks as this is the message that loads of kids take on board when starting smoking it. Yes loads of people can happily toke for years without really noticing any major negative effects, but then there are loads of people who do suffer negative effects (often fairly mild, but still negative) and a few where it tips them over the edge psycologically. I don't need any research papers to tell me this is the case (and probably wouldn't trust most of them anyway) I know it to be true from the number of people I know who've given up / drastically cut down on the amount they're smoking due to the negative effects it was having on them, and their comments on how much better they're feeling for doing this... as well as my own personal experience which never amounted to much more than realising that the amount I was smoking was seriously affecting my ability to get things done.

Having said that I don't think it should be illegal, and think that the most harmful effects of weed on people is the illegality of it, criminal records etc.

In the grand scheme of things it's relatively harmless, but it ain't as benign as some would make out.

and that's my considered opinion on the matter, take it as you will... fs
